Transaction 373cdcb13a565aca0333823fff188e2aac91a000f7d70d866c267685bbfb9085

1 Input
2 Outputs
  • 373cdcb13a565aca0333823fff188e2aac91a000f7d70d866c267685bbfb9085:0
  • value  1000000
    address  2MupiDcSDBRmFbuZBsF6y75wMY9zTyNSxun
  • 373cdcb13a565aca0333823fff188e2aac91a000f7d70d866c267685bbfb9085:1
  • value  2099668
    address  2MtvPk7VAZv1eTHp19ZWMVMxms8zuY3i1Z4